This position is responsible for providing support to their respective process team per Manufacturing Standard for Operational Excellence (MSOE) 602, specifically focusing on safety, quality and manufacturing performance. Perform actual duties in an assigned area within the biopharmaceutical bulk products production facility.  Duties are listed below and are specific to the assigned area (Cell Culture, Purification, or BioServices).  The processing areas are PLC automated and controlled via HMI.  Cell Culture operations contains major equipment such as bioreactors, centrifuges, and biosafety cabinets.  Protein Purification operations contains major equipment such as chromatography columns, chromatography / TFF skids, and intermediate product vessels.  BioServices encompasses Media Prep, Buffer Prep, and general equipment cleaning and preparation supporting both Cell Culture and Purification.  Major equipment for this area includes stainless steel vessels, autoclaves, and washers.  All three major manufacturing departments utilize filtration technologies.
